Handover note — Crumbwheel order cutoffs.

Welcome aboard. The bakery cutoff rule in Crumbwheel closes same-day orders at 14:00 local to each storefront, not UTC — this has bitten us twice. Holiday overrides live in the calendar service and take precedence silently, so always check there first when a cutoff looks wrong. To unlock the calendar service's admin console after a restart, enter the recovery passphrase below.

vault phrase of bagap-bahaf = silion-pelox-sorox-casdor-quenwyn-fraax-eliox-praael-kelion-quenvan-kasox-rusael-norius-belvan

### Step 4 — Deploy the Quillmark encoding detector

The detector service sniffs uploaded text files (BOM check, then heuristic scan) before they hit the Ostergale parser. Build from the release tag, not main. Confirm the confidence threshold is set to 0.85 in prod config. Run the smoke suite against the sample corpus. Push the signed image to the registry using the deploy key below.

release key, fajef-kajeg: bky19_LdLu6Ne6FLi8he2c24d

## Ownership

The Moonwake backfill scheduler is owned by the Datamoor platform team. All changes to the partitioning logic, retry policy, or cron expressions require review from the designated owner — reviewers should not approve these paths on their own. The scheduler runs nightly against production warehouses, so a subtle bug can silently corrupt weeks of aggregates; treat every diff here as high-risk. CI includes a replay harness; confirm it passed before approving. Escalations and final approvals go to the owner named below.

approver of faduf-bagug = Framir Sorwyn